new diterpenoids from the rhizomes of Hedychium forrestii
Natural Product Research, 2021Co-Authors: Wenhui Wang, Jiejie Gao, Xiaofei Zuo, Xujie Qin, Haiyang Liu, Qing ZhaoAbstract:A novel hexanorditerpenoid, hedychin C (1), and a new diterpenoid, hedychin D (2), were isolated from the rhizomes of Hedychium forrestii. Their structures and absolute configurations were unambiguously established by means of extensive spectroscopic data (IR, UV, HRMS, and NMR) and electronic circular dichroism (ECD) calculations. This is the first report of naturally occurring labdane-type hexanorditerpenoid. Compound 1 was proved to have moderate cytotoxicity against XWLC-05 cell line with an IC50 value of 53.6 μM.

hedychins a and b 6 7 dinorlabdane diterpenoids with a peroxide bridge from Hedychium forrestii
Organic Letters, 2018Co-Authors: Qing Zhao, Jiejie Gao, Xujie Qin, Xiaojiang Hao, Haiyang LiuAbstract:Hedychins A (1) and B (2), two unprecedented 6,7-dinorlabdane ditepenoids with a peroxide bridge, were obtained from the rhizomes of Hedychium forrestii. Their structures and absolute configurations were unequivocally established by a combination of spectroscopic data and X-ray single-crystal diffractions. Their plausible biosynthetic pathway was proposed. Compound 2 exhibited cytotoxicity against HepG2 and XWLC-05 cell lines with IC50 values of 8.0 and 19.7 μM, respectively.

phytochemical investigation of labdane diterpenes from the rhizomes of Hedychium spicatum and their cytotoxic activity
Bioorganic & Medicinal Chemistry Letters, 2009Co-Authors: Prabhakar P Reddy, B S Sastry, Madhusudana J Rao, Ranga R Rao, J Shashidhar, Suresh K BabuAbstract:A comprehensive reinvestigation of chemical constituents from the rhizomes of Hedychium spicatum led to the isolation of two new labdane-type diterpene (1, 2), together with six known compounds (3-8). Their structures were established on the basis of extensive spectroscopic (IR, MS, 2D NMR) data analysis and by comparison with the spectroscopic data reported in the literature. In addition, all the isolates were tested for their cytotoxicity against the THP-1 (human acute monocytic leukemia), HL-60 (human promyelocytic leukemia), A-375 (human malignant melanoma) and A-549 (human lung carcinoma) cancerous cell lines.

new labdane diterpenes as intestinal α glucosidase inhibitor from antihyperglycemic extract of Hedychium spicatum ham ex smith rhizomes
Bioorganic & Medicinal Chemistry Letters, 2009Co-Authors: Prabhakar P Reddy, Ashok K Tiwari, Ranga R Rao, K Madhusudhana, Rama Subba V Rao, Amtul Z Ali, Suresh K Babu, Madhusudana J RaoAbstract:Abstract Phytochemical investigation of antihyperglycemic extract of rhizomes of Hedychium spicatum led to the isolation of two new labdane type diterpenes 2, 3 along with seven known compounds (1, 4–9). Their structures were established on the basis of NMR (1D and 2D) and mass spectroscopic analysis. The new compound 2 displayed strong intestinal α-glucosidase inhibitory activity. Other compounds also displayed varying degree of intestinal α-glucosidase inhibitory potential.

two new cytotoxic diterpenes from the rhizomes of Hedychium spicatum
Bioorganic & Medicinal Chemistry Letters, 2009Co-Authors: Prabhakar P Reddy, Ranga R Rao, Suresh K Babu, K Rekha, J Shashidhar, G Shashikiran, Vijaya V Lakshmi, Madhusudana J RaoAbstract:Phytochemical investigation of CHCl3 extract of the rhizomes of Hedychium spicatum led to the isolation of two new labdane-type diterpenes, compounds 1 and 2 along with five known compounds (3–7). Their structures were established on the basis of NMR (1D and 2D) and mass spectroscopic analysis. In addition, all the isolates were tested for their cytotoxicity against the Colo-205 (Colo-cancer), A-431 (skin cancer), MCF-7 (breast cancer), A-549 (lung cancer) and Chinese hamster ovary cells (CHO). Two new compounds 1 and 2 were shown good cytotoxic activity.

a new convenient method for quantitative analysis of hedychenone an anti inflammatory compound in the rhizomes of Hedychium spicatum buch hem
Jpc-journal of Planar Chromatography-modern Tlc, 2007Co-Authors: P V Srinivas, Sekar Anubala, V U M Sarma, B S Sastry, Madhusudana J RaoAbstract:Plants of the Hedychium genus are perennial rhizomatus plants belonging to the Zingiberaceae family. Extracts of Zingiberacaea have long been used in traditional medicine. A simple, precise, and convenient HPTLC method has been established for analysis of hedychenone, the major marker compound extracted from the rhizomes of Hedychium spicatum (Buch-Hem). Chromatography was performed on silica gel 60F 254 plates with ethyl acetate-hexane, 20 + 80 ( v/v ), as mobile phase. Detection and quantification were performed densitometrically at λ max = 254 nm with hedychenone as external standard. The method is characterized by high sensitivity and linearity over a wide range of concentrations.
